Actually, i have come up with a new strategy thats allowed me to actually play more than 1 game in a row without it happening.
First i used to not press spacebar at all while downed but by the end it didn't seem to matter and i could give up if i felt like it, But if someone was about to revive me or anything else happening, Stop pressing any buttons! When i get to the spawn screen i wait several seconds. like 5 at the least (hindsight: Not necessarily this long actually, but only calm clicks and presses.) This is the important part:. And when i choose my spawn spot i do not spam the spawn button (ie. space bar or clickling) I just select a spot and wait for the deploy button to change to show spawning is possible (ie. not greyed out due to there being comba.) And then after the game i leave, or even alt+f4 if the game doesn't let me leave, before the next round starts. If i dont play two games in a row by having the matchmaking start a new game straight after the other, ive managed to avoid this problem slightly better.
(Which is a shame because it makes playing with friends impossible, or such a hassle you have to be really good friends for them to put up with this because of you. !Also a shame if you get a really good squad that works together and it'd be great to continue playing with them. but you cant... you have to leave the game.)
- Dont spam spacebar or the "deploy" button in spawn screen.
- Dont press spacebar while youre downed. ( Unless fully clear of any potential rez or something, careful with it. )
- Never play two games in a row, leave the match before another starts an then start a new matchmaking.
- If the bug happens and you have to alt+f4 then repair gamefiles before starting.
- Edit: Forgot to add. I also set the games graphics to performance mode and all other settings to defaults other than controls, especially the hud settings, i have a feeling adjusting fov might affect this. (again not sure, but this way its worked best for me). Nvidia low latency + boost was fine to turn on as the only change from defaults. Turning on AA immediately cause the bug. (Do this even if you have a 5090, because it happens to anyone, no matter how good your hardware is.)
- Possibly optional, but to lower the settings as much as possible i made a user.cfg file, as per someone instructing people having low performance. Its just creating a new notepad file and then saving it as user.cfg and choosing "All files" instead of .txt

Simply copy paste that into the text file and then save as user.cfg (all files), then place it in the same folder where the game executable is. after doing this the bug almost never happened again, but i was still stuck with performance mode obviously.
These steps have allowed me to actually play more of the game, I'm too scared to immediately give up the downed phase either because i feel the bug sometimes happens that way too (because you press spacebar while not alive). Basically, everytime im dead or downed i treat the spacebar like it has the monkey pox on it, i dont even touch my keyboard.
Sooner or later the spawning can become more difficult because even though the spawn is available. Even though you calmly click once or press space once, you do not spawn. This seems like the first signs that the bug is coming. But you might be able to avoid it till the round ends still, but you start having to click or press the deploy button multiple times to actually spawn. Again even at spawns where there should be nothing stopping you from spawning. Im fully aware you cant spawn on squadmates in combat... But thats the thing, the games instinct is to he spamming that deploy button if that last squad member gets even a second of time not in combat and you might save that push, but this way, you have to wait and you might miss the window, but better that than ruining the whole rest of the match for yourself.
To me it seems like a progressive thing, like a memory leak maybe, for multiple reasons. Like it getting progressively worse when it starts. and it seemingly having "warning signs" that its about to happen. The firsts signs being the need to click or press space bar multiple times to spawn even in completely safe spawns. Also sounds becoming distorted is a sign its getting really bad. It does not seem graphics related, because people with both better and worse hardware than me get it.
